Veronica Curtin (born 1979 or 1980)[1] is a former inter-county camogie player with Galway.
[3][4] With a total of 5-15, she was the sixth highest scoring player in the 2011 Senior Camogie Championship.
[citation needed] She was 16 when she was part of the Galway senior team that won Galway's first ever All-Ireland Senior Camogie Championship title in 1996.
[1] She scored 1-5 out of Galway's total of 1-6 when her county won the 2005 National Camogie League final.
[6] She scored two goals in Galway's All Ireland semi-final draw with Cork in the 2010 championship.
